Skip to content

✨ Welcome to BeyondLife, an innovative prototype app that transforms the concept of a digital legacy into a simplified interactive experience. The project aims to explore the future of posthumous data management, making it simple and easy to set up, manage, and securely share a digital will. 🔒

Notifications You must be signed in to change notification settings

Xinzhang-Chen/BeyondLife

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

11 Commits
 
 

Repository files navigation

BeyondLife

💡 BeyondLife: Third-Party Digital Will Application 💻

Expo React Native

✨ Welcome to BeyondLife, an innovative prototype app that transforms the concept of a digital legacy into a simplified interactive experience. The project aims to explore the future of posthumous data management, making it simple and easy to set up, manage, and securely share a digital will. 🔒


🌟 Key Features

  • 🧭 Interactive Will Setup
    Embark on a guided and fun journey to add heirs, assign permissions, and craft your digital legacy in just a few clicks.

  • 🔗 Cross-Platform Integration
    Easily connect to platforms like Google Drive and Twitter to manage and secure your digital treasures.

  • 🎨 Visually Intuitive Design
    Built with simplicity in mind—whether you're a tech whiz or not, BeyondLife has you covered!

  • 🔒 Privacy-Focused Security
    No leaks, no risks! Your data stays encrypted and accessible only to your trusted recipients. In BeyondLife, we implemented and integrated a customized Attribute-Based Encryption (ABE) scheme, called PD-CP-ABE (Partially Decryptable Ciphertext Policy Attribute-Based Encryption).

Explore the PD-CP-ABE Implementation: Visit the PD-CP-ABE Repo

Encryption Performance Comparison of PD-CP-ABE and bsw07

File Size (Files) PD-CP-ABE (s) Avg Time PD-CP-ABE (s) Std Dev bsw07 (s) Avg Time bsw07 (s) Std Dev
5 0.1652 0.0532 0.1513 0.0047
160 0.8574 0.0057 3.6726 0.0239
1500 0.8719 0.0169 31.5530 0.1992
  • ⚙️ Dynamic Configurations
    Adaptable workflows for managing cloud storage, email, social media, or any other platform you choose.

🎉 Live Demo

📱 Want to see it in action? Access the live demo now via Expo:

👉 🚀 Launch the Demo 👈

Note: As this is a prototype, performance may vary based on your device and network speed.
Additionally, the backend server is deployed on a personal desktop and may not be available 24/7.


🔮 Future Potential

While BeyondLife is already paving the way for digital legacy management, there's always room to grow! Here’s what could be next:

  1. 🤖 AI-Assisted Guidance
    Let AI simplify complex setups and guide you through estate planning like a pro.

  2. 🌐 Expanded Platform Support
    Add integrations for services like Dropbox, Instagram, and more.

  3. 📜 Legal Compliance
    Align the app with international legal standards to make your digital will enforceable across borders.

  4. 🌈 Personalized Experiences
    Offer customizable themes and tailored recommendations for a more personal touch.


⚠️ Disclaimer

This repository contains no source code—it serves solely as a demonstration resource for the BeyondLife prototype hosted via Expo.

🔍 BeyondLife is designed for research and concept exploration. It is not intended for production use or the management of sensitive personal data. Evaluate and enjoy this app as a prototype, not as a finalized product.


❗️ Demo Version Details:

The current demo version is a simplified version of the full application. It currently supports setting up a digital will for X (formerly Twitter), while support for Gmail and Google Drive will be included in the full version.

To ensure data security for demo users (e.g., avoiding accidental deletion of personal tweets), the demo allows users to link their private Twitter accounts but does not use the authorized token to retrieve or modify any data. Instead, predefined sample tweets are provided for testing purposes.

However, the cloud storage link is fully functional in this demo version. During interactions, BeyondLife will upload encrypted data to the demo user’s cloud storage.


📸 Screenshots

Take a look at some screenshots of BeyondLife in action!

User Login and Registration

Heir Config 1 Heir Config 2 Heir Config 3

Connect to Cloud Platforms

Heir Config 3 Heir Config 2 Heir Config 1

Heir Configuration

Heir Config 1 Heir Config 2 Heir Config 3 Heir Config 2 Heir Config 3 Heir Config 3

Interactive Will Setup

Will Setup 1 Will Setup 2 Will Setup 3 Will Setup 1 Will Setup 2 Will Setup 3 Will Setup 1 Will Setup 2 Will Setup 3

Will Activation and Accessing inherited data

Data Upload 1 Data Upload 2 Data Upload 3 Data Upload 3 Data Upload 3

🚀 Ready to Secure Your Digital Legacy?

Click below to take the first step toward simplifying your posthumous data management:

👉 Try the Demo Now! 👈

About

✨ Welcome to BeyondLife, an innovative prototype app that transforms the concept of a digital legacy into a simplified interactive experience. The project aims to explore the future of posthumous data management, making it simple and easy to set up, manage, and securely share a digital will. 🔒

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published